Jards Macalé Announces London Show In March 2024

by | Feb 1, 2024

Having worked with some of the biggest names in Brazilian music (Joao Donato, Gal Costa, Caetano Veloso and more), Jards Macalé has gained status as one of the most influential samba and tropicalia artists of his generation and has announced a special live show at the Jazz Café, London, United Kingdom on 10th March 2024.

Macalé’s live performances embody the untamed spirit and boundless musical freedom that define him, where the past intertwines with the present in a breathtaking display of artistic prowess.In 2022, Macalé celebrated the 50th anniversary of his debut solo album, a groundbreaking masterpiece released by Philips in 1972. This iconic record gave us timeless tracks such as Vapor Barato, Mal Secreto, Farinha do Desprezo, Revendo Amigos, and Hotel das Estrelas. It infused samba and bossa nova with the fiery essence of rock, classical harmonies and the improvisational spirit of jazz. As the years passed, a new generation of musicians and fans discovered this gem, fuelling its resurgent popularity and inspiring fresh collaborations. Last year, Macalé assembled a formidable new band for an exhilarating homage to his illustrious body of work, with Gui Held on guitar, Pedro Dantas on bass, and Thoma Harres on drums.
